1950 Supreme(Mad) 380

BASHEER AHMED SAYEED
Mariyala Sambayya. – Appellant
Versus
Narala Bala Subba Reddi. – Respondent


Advocates:
N. Subramanyam. for Petitioner.
W. Kothandaramayya for Respondents.

Judgment.-

The petitioner has preferred this revision against the order of the learned District Munsiff overruling his objection to the interpleader suit filed by the 1st respondent in the revision. The suit filed by the petitioner was one for recovery of a sum of Rs. 600 due under a pronote executed by the 1st respondent in favour of Garudamma and transferred to him. In the written statement filed by the respondent to that suit by the petitioner he pleaded inter alia that the original promisee Garudamma was not in law entitled to transfer the pronote in question and that the adopted son of Garudamma was entitled to the amount and further that he had already paid Rs. 200 on behalf of the pronote amount to Garudamma in the presence of the petitioner himself, who is no other than the maternal uncle of the original promisee. Issues have been framed in the original suit. After the framing of the issues, in consequence of certain notices issued by the adopted son to the respondent claiming the amount due on the promissory note, the respondent filed an interpleader suit to which objections have been taken by the petitioner.
